Abstract :
Two different porphyrin derivatives (H2TPP(m-OPh)4 and Rh(III)TPP(m-OPh)4) were investigated with respect to their capability to help resolution of five model aromatic peptides in capillary electrophoresis/open tubular capillary electrochromatography. Though the main separation mechanism was preferentially based on the ionic properties of the separated analytes, involvement of particularly H2TPP(m-OPh)4–peptide interactions at alkaline pH (8.0) was clearly demonstrated. In combination with Tris–phosphate buffer, a speed up of the separation was observed at pH 2.25 (particularly if Rh(III)TPP(m-OPh)4 was used as capillary coating); in spite of the speed up of the separation the selectivity of the system was sufficient and resulted in a complete separation of the five model peptides. It can be expected that Rh(III)TPP(m-OPh)4 capillary coating in combination with Tris–phosphate buffer can be generally used for a considerable speeding up of lengthy separations of peptides in acidic media with some decrease in the separation power of the system.
